Using the topological flux insertion procedure, the ground-state degeneracy of an insulator on a periodic lattice with filling factor $\nu=p/q$ was found to be at least $q$-fold. Applying the same argument in a lattice with edges, we show that the degeneracy is modified by the additional edge density $\nu_{\mysw{E}}$ associated with the open boundaries. In particular, we demonstrate that these edge corrections may even make an insulator with integer bulk filling degenerate.
